What is an EUDI Wallet App?
The EUDI Wallet App is a digital container designed to securely store and share Verifiable Credentials (VCs) issued by trusted authorities. These credentials have the same legal recognition as physical IDs and are accepted across all 27 EU member states.
Key Capabilities:
Store official identity documents like ID cards, driver’s licenses, health records, and academic diplomas.
Leverage Zero-Knowledge Proofs (ZKPs) to allow selective data sharing.
Support Qualified Electronic Signatures (QES) for legally binding digital transactions.
Enable businesses to verify customer identity instantly in a GDPR-compliant manner.
The EUDI Wallet is not just another ID app—it is a legally recognized gateway to seamless cross-border services.
How Does an EUDI Wallet App Work?
The system follows a trust triangle model with three key roles:
Issuer: Governments, universities, and banks issue cryptographically signed verifiable credentials.
Holder: The user stores credentials in their wallet and shares them when required.
Relying Party: Businesses or services that need to verify user identity, such as banks, online portals, or mobility providers.
Typical Workflow:
Service Request: The user applies for a service (e.g., opening a bank account).
Data Request: The bank requests specific credentials, such as proof of age or residency.
User Consent: The user consents to share minimal required data using selective disclosure.
Verification: Credentials are verified instantly by checking cryptographic signatures against EU’s trusted issuers list.
Outcome: The interaction is secure, compliant, and legally recognized across the EU.
Step-by-Step EUDI Wallet App Development Process
Step 1: Align with eIDAS 2.0 and ARF
The foundation of an EUDI Wallet app lies in strict alignment with eIDAS 2.0 regulations and the Architectural Reference Framework (ARF). This guarantees full interoperability and ensures future-proof compliance with EU mandates.
Step 2: Build a Secure Identity Infrastructure
Use Secure Elements (SEs) or Trusted Execution Environments (TEEs) to protect user data.
Employ Hardware Security Modules (HSMs) for cryptographic key generation and secure storage.
Implement Public Key Infrastructure (PKI) to establish verifiable trust chains.
Step 3: Integrate Verifiable Credentials & Decentralized Identifiers
Incorporate W3C Verifiable Credentials (VCs) for tamper-proof digital proof.
Use Decentralized Identifiers (DIDs) for user-managed identity.
Support issuance of academic diplomas, financial proofs, health records, and professional certifications.
Step 4: Enable Selective Disclosure & Zero-Knowledge Proofs
Allow users to prove attributes like age or citizenship without revealing unnecessary details.
Integrate zk-SNARKs and zk-STARKs libraries for privacy-first cryptographic verifications.
Step 5: Ensure Cross-Border Interoperability
Adopt OpenID for Verifiable Credentials (OID4VC) for EU-wide compatibility.
Test interoperability with European Large-Scale Pilots to ensure seamless cross-country operation.
Step 6: Design Intuitive User Experience
Develop transparent and user-friendly consent flows.
Support offline verification for scenarios like airport security or event entry.
Integrate multilingual interfaces for pan-European accessibility.
Step 7: Certification & Accreditation
Work with regulatory bodies to achieve Qualified Trust Service Provider (QTSP) status.
Conduct rigorous security audits to validate technical and legal compliance.
Step 8: Enable Qualified Electronic Signatures
Integrate QES functionality into the wallet.
Ensure businesses and individuals can sign legal documents online with full EU recognition.
Step 9: Implement Ongoing Compliance & Updates
Continuously monitor EU regulations for changes.
Deliver software updates and integrate new standards as they evolve.
Maintain strong security patches to protect credentials from emerging cyber threats.

Common Challenges in EUDI Wallet App Development
Compliance Complexity
Navigating eIDAS 2.0 and ARF requirements can be overwhelming. To overcome this, businesses should engage experts who specialize in certification and audits.
High-Security Needs
With Level of Assurance (LoA High) requirements, wallets must withstand sophisticated attacks. Secure, multi-layered infrastructure is critical.
Interoperability Issues
Different EU member states may adapt wallets slightly differently. Early and proactive real-world interoperability tests can resolve edge-case challenges.
Tools and APIs for EUDI Wallet Development
Identity Standards: OpenID Connect, OID4VC, and W3C VC libraries.
Cryptography: zk-SNARKs, zk-STARKs, PKI systems.
Secure Hardware: Trusted Execution Environments, Secure Elements, HSMs.
Integration APIs: KYC APIs, payment gateways (Stripe, PayPal, SEPA), and document verification (Jumio, Onfido).

FAQs
How does an EUDI Wallet differ from other ID apps?
Unlike standard digital ID apps, EUDI Wallets are legally equivalent to physical IDs and comply with strict EU regulations under eIDAS 2.0.
Can private companies build EUDI Wallets?
Yes, private companies can develop EUDI Wallet applications but must undergo certification to ensure they meet EU’s compliance and security requirements.
Which technologies ensure security in EUDI wallets?
EUDI Wallets use Zero-Knowledge Proofs, Secure Elements, Hardware Security Modules, and Verifiable Credentials to offer the highest level of cryptographic and operational security.
Are EUDI Wallets mandatory?
Yes, by 2026 all EU member states must provide at least one wallet, and by 2027 large online platforms and businesses must accept them.
